One of my favorite things we stumbled across was this man selling paper cut-outs. Paper cut-outs are an ancient Chinese art. I am amazed at what they can make just from paper and scissors. Warren (our friend) decided to buy some of the art and the man told him that he would give him something. And then, to our amazement, he told Warren to look to the side and in mere moments, he had cut out his silhouette. The vendor then proceeded to make a silhouette for each of the kids.
